How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wilton Drive?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Wilton Drive Studio Apartments | $2,008 | $1,250 | $2,655 |
Wilton Drive 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,001 | $1,200 | $3,839 |
Wilton Drive 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,854 | $1,675 | $6,554 |
Wilton Drive 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,225 | $2,550 | $3,750 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Wilton Drive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Wilton Drive with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Wilton Drive is at River Oaks Apartments listed at $1,275.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Wilton Drive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Wilton Drive is $2,001.
